Governance Pact

The rules every deliverable follows

The Governance Pact is the set of commitments that apply to every artifact we produce, regardless of format or audience.

  • Each claim has a source, confidence level, and usage rules
  • Stats are footnoted and traceable
  • A do-not-use list exists for weak or outdated stats
  • Review gates and assumptions are documented before delivery
  • Confidentiality and conflicts are handled before work begins

Verity Standard

How we test what we ship

The Verity Standard is our claims-testing protocol. It defines how every non-trivial assertion is sourced, graded, and cleared before it enters a deliverable.

Source traceability

Every claim maps to at least one primary or authoritative source.

Confidence grading

Claims are graded by evidence strength. Low-confidence claims are flagged or excluded.

Usage rules

Each claim carries explicit rules: where it can be cited, who approved it, and when it expires.
